What factors led to the rise of the corporation after 1865? What means did corporate leaders use to expand their control of mark
svlad2 [7]
<span>In the early nineteenth century, the corporate form of business organization had been used to raise large amounts of start-up capital for transportation enterprises such as turnpikes and canals. By selling stocks and bonds to raise money, the corporation separated the company’s managers, who guided its day-to-day operation, from the owners—those who had purchased the stocks and bonds as investments.

Can someone please summarize the reconstruction era for me? the period after the civil war
BARSIC [14]
<span>Reconstruction and led to the triumph of the more radical wing of the Republican Party. During Radical Reconstruction, which began in 1867, newly enfranchised blacks gained a voice in government for the first time in American history, winning election to southern state legislatures and even to the U.S. Congress. In less than a decade, however, reactionary forces–including the Ku Klux Klan–would reverse the changes wrought by Radical Reconstruction in a violent backlash that restored white supremacy in the South.</span>
